According to Artprice, Bruno Cantais's value in 2021 ranges around 600-2000 euros for his paintings and limited edition prints, making him a relatively affordable artist for art collectors.
A compulsive and spontaneous creator, Bruno Cantais lives in Lyon; he explores several techniques, ranging from abstract expressionism to Rauchenberg or De Kooning, to matter projections à la Georges Mathieu, to Pop Art collage or the expressionism of Karel Appel, who traverses the borders between abstract gesture and figurative representation. But his hallmark remains this physical painting, this material worked by the body, a testimony to the artist's intimate monologue. Artist represented at Galerie les couleurs de l'éternité in France, gallery modern dutchart in the Netherlands. Listed on Artprice, Drouot and Akoun since 2005. Atelier Maeght in 2005. Recently participated in the Art3f fair in Lyon. Recent exhibitions in Chisinau in Moldova, Cannes, Pézenas and Lyon Abbaye de Paul Bocuse gala evening 2023. Paris gallery private collection Île Saint Louis since 2016. Exhibits in international galleries Belgium, USA, Italy and Portugal since 2019.
